feat: ContextVM (MCP over Nostr) server with full integration
Complete CVM implementation: persistent WebSocket relay listener, kind 25910 event subscription, MCP protocol handlers, CEP-6 announcements, 10 MCP tools, per-board hardware locks, WiFi EU regulatory fix. Architecture: - cvm_server.c: WS relay listener, kind 25910 subscription, MCP dispatch - mcp_handler.c/h: 10 MCP tools (get_config, set_config, get_balance, wallet_send, get_sessions, get_usage, set_payout, set_metric, set_price, wallet_melt) - Responses published via existing WS connection (not new TLS) - Auth check: only owner npub accepted - CEP-6: kinds 11316 (server), 11317 (tools), 10002 (relay list) - WS ping/pong keepalive every 30s, 60s TLS read timeout Critical fixes: - WiFi country code DE (ESP-IDF defaults to CN, breaks EU APs) - Subscription #p filter must be array not string - Use-after-free: tags_str freed before nostr_event_to_json - MCP responses via existing WS (ESP32 can't open multiple TLS) - EVENT msg buffer underflow, WS frame masking, TLS write loop Per-board hardware locks: - Lock files in physical-router-test-automation/locks/ - lock-a/b/c, unlock-a/b/c targets in 3 Makefiles - All hardware-touching targets require board lock Verified on Board B via relay.primal.net: - 282 unit tests passing (61 CVM + 60 MCP + 161 existing) - MCP initialize roundtrip: PASS - tools/list: PASS - tools/call get_config: PASS - tools/call get_balance: PASS - tools/call set_price: PASS (write operation) - CEP-6 announcements (11316, 11317, 10002): all accepted by relay - WiFi STA connection (EnterSSID-2.4GHz): PASS with country code DE - Board A WiFi confirmed hardware issue (not firmware)
